Spaces:
Sleeping
Sleeping
ouh
Browse files
app.py
CHANGED
@@ -87,9 +87,8 @@ def main():
|
|
87 |
competition = competition_info[0]
|
88 |
if not competition_summaries[competition].empty:
|
89 |
# get only competition sumaries that heppen after latest evaluation time
|
90 |
-
|
91 |
-
|
92 |
-
evaluation_time = pd.Timestamp(evaluation_timexd)
|
93 |
filtered_competition_summaries = competition_summaries[competition][competition_summaries[competition]["Created At"] > evaluation_time]
|
94 |
# get all winning hotkeys and number of wins
|
95 |
winning_hotkeys = filtered_competition_summaries["Winning Hotkey"].value_counts()
|
|
|
87 |
competition = competition_info[0]
|
88 |
if not competition_summaries[competition].empty:
|
89 |
# get only competition sumaries that heppen after latest evaluation time
|
90 |
+
evaluation_time = get_latest_evaluation_time(competition_info[1])
|
91 |
+
|
|
|
92 |
filtered_competition_summaries = competition_summaries[competition][competition_summaries[competition]["Created At"] > evaluation_time]
|
93 |
# get all winning hotkeys and number of wins
|
94 |
winning_hotkeys = filtered_competition_summaries["Winning Hotkey"].value_counts()
|
utils.py
CHANGED
@@ -57,7 +57,9 @@ def get_latest_evaluation_time(evaluation_times):
|
|
57 |
yesterday = current_utc_datetime - timedelta(days=1)
|
58 |
latest_eval_time = eval_times[-1]
|
59 |
|
60 |
-
|
|
|
|
|
61 |
|
62 |
|
63 |
def fetch_competition_summary(api, entity, project):
|
|
|
57 |
yesterday = current_utc_datetime - timedelta(days=1)
|
58 |
latest_eval_time = eval_times[-1]
|
59 |
|
60 |
+
# Return the latest evaluation time from yesterday as pd.Timestamp
|
61 |
+
latest_time = yesterday.replace(hour=latest_eval_time.hour, minute=latest_eval_time.minute, second=0, microsecond=0)
|
62 |
+
return pd.Timestamp(latest_time, tz='UTC')
|
63 |
|
64 |
|
65 |
def fetch_competition_summary(api, entity, project):
|